Pohang City is actively working to discover and nurture outstanding hydrogen companies within the region that will lead the hydrogen economy.

The city is implementing the ‘2023 Preliminary Hydrogen Specialized Company Development Support Project’ to foster local hydrogen-related companies as hydrogen specialized companies designated by the Ministry of Trade, Industry and Energy (hereinafter referred to as the Ministry of Industry).
This project, carried out by Pohang Technopark (hereinafter Pohang TP) with a total budget investment of 550 million KRW from Pohang City and Gyeongbuk Province, supports the entire process of technology commercialization for hydrogen fuel cell-related companies located in Pohang that possess excellent technology and business items in the hydrogen fuel cell field, and further helps them grow into ‘hydrogen specialized companies’ recognized by the Ministry of Industry.
The 2023 Preliminary Hydrogen Specialized Company Development Support Project accepts applications from Pohang-based companies with high growth potential and technological competitiveness at Pohang TP from the 3rd to the 24th.
The selected companies are divided into one company with an average sales revenue of 2 billion KRW or more over the past three years and seven companies with less than 2 billion KRW, all of which must have their headquarters or branches located in Pohang.
Pohang City plans to support technology commercialization such as prototype production, certification, intellectual property acquisition, and exhibition participation.
Selected preliminary hydrogen specialized companies will receive up to 100 million KRW in corporate support for prototype production, certification/intellectual property, and exhibition fields, as well as opportunities for consulting by specialized institutions to apply for Ministry of Industry hydrogen specialized company verification according to sales revenue requirements.
Hydrogen specialized companies are those confirmed by the Ministry of Industry under Article 11 of the Act on the Promotion of Hydrogen Economy and Hydrogen Safety Management, where the proportion of sales revenue or investment amount related to hydrogen business exceeds a certain ratio of total sales revenue. These companies can receive government support such as hydrogen-related technology development, commercialization, subsidies, and loans.
Pohang City plans to maximize synergy by collaborating with excellent hydrogen companies leading the local hydrogen economy, linked with the hydrogen fuel cell power generation cluster and the hydrogen fuel cell certification center, to advance as an eco-friendly hydrogen economy hub city.
The city was selected for the Ministry of Industry’s hydrogen convergence complex demonstration project at the Pohang Blue Valley National Industrial Complex, and a preliminary feasibility study for establishing a hydrogen fuel cell power generation cluster is currently underway.
The Hydrogen Fuel Cell Certification Center (located within Pohang TP), currently operating as a KOLAS (Korea Laboratory Accreditation Scheme) accredited testing institution, is also preparing to be designated as a KS (Korean Industrial Standards) certification entrusted testing institution in the hydrogen fuel cell field.
Additionally, since Pohang was selected as a target area for the Ministry of Land, Infrastructure and Transport’s hydrogen city creation project last August, it plans to proceed with establishing a master plan for hydrogen city creation this year to officially start the project.
